阅读理解。

     On June 30, 2009, a Yemenia airplane from Paris to Comoros, Africa, crashed into the Indian Ocean.
There were 153 people on the plane, including some French officials. Though people have been searching
since the plane went down, the result looked unpleasant, for most of the passengers might be in bad luck.
     But a 13-year-old girl called Bahia Bakari was discovered in the water, where she had been staying afloat
(漂浮的) by holding a piece of wreckage (残骸) from the plane tightly fo over 13 hours. When they found
her, the girl was too weak to catch he lifebuoy (救生圈) thrown to her, instead, a Comoran police officer,
said Abdilai, jumped into the water to pull the child onto the boat.
     Bahia Bakari was injured, especially her collarbone (锁骨) her father was pleased to see his daughter
although his wife had gone away in this tragedy. He said that his daughter could hardly swim. It was really
a miracle for her to escape in this way. In her daddy"s warm arms, the girl could soon remember what she
had experienced."I was thrown out of the plane and then I saw the plane fall into the water. Next I found
myself in the water. I couldn"t swim very well and I caught something but I didn"t know what is was," said
the girl.
     "She is really a lucky young girl," said Alain Joyandet, France"s minister for International Cooperation.
